types of Indian Evisa , Indian Electronic Visas (E-visas) are among the most popular visa types for travellers visiting India. E-visas enable tourists, business travellers, and medical travellers to apply for visas, anywhere in the world without the need to visit an embassy or consulate. Applicants are able to apply for visas on the Indian government’s official website and receive their visa within 5-7 days. E-visas are valid for up to six months and allow tourists to stay in India for up to 60 days. There are several types of E-visas available to applicants, some of the most popular are the tourist visa, business visa, and medical visa.

The tourist E-visa is the most popular and widely applied visa option by international travellers coming to India. The tourist visa allows tourists to travel to India for tourism and leisure purposes and can be applied for a single entry or multiple entries over a three-year period. The business E-visa is suitable for those travelling for business, educational seminars, and other professional reasons. The medical E-visa is a good option for medical travellers who wish to come to India for medical treatments, surgeries, or any other medical assistance. This type of visa allows a maximum stay of up to 90 days.

While Indian E-visas are gaining popularity among travellers, many applicants still have difficulty understanding the rejection or delay in their visa applications. Below are some of the most common F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ions) about Indian visas and reasons for Indian visa rejections.

1. Does it take long for the Indian E-visa to be granted?

It usually takes 5-7 days for the visa to be processed. However, the actual time can vary depending on several factors such as the applicant’s nationality and requested visa type.

2. Are there any additional documents I must submit while applying for an Indian E-visa?

Yes, some documents must be submitted as proof such as a passport, valid address proof, recent photos and other required documents.

3. What are the common reasons my Indian visa might be rejected?

The most common reasons forIndian Visa Rejected include incomplete or inaccurate information, insufficient financial means to cover the duration of stay, inadequate photo or passport, or failed background checks.

4. How Can I check the status of my Indian E-visa?

You can access the visa status by entering your passport details on the Indian government’s official website. You can also contact their customer service for assistance.
